Republic of Ireland 2 Slovenia 0
The Republic of Ireland Under 15 side have defeated Slovenia, 2-0 in Whitehall, Dublin this evening. The home side were set for retribution after they were punished for not taking their chances in the first game of this double International Friendly which they lost 2-1.
Vincent Butlers men started brightly, dominating midfield possession but failed to create any clear cut chances up front. Karl Shephard opened the scoring after 35 minutes when captain, Conor Clifford made a strong run through midfield and when Dinko Catic in the Slovenian goal failed to grasp the long range effort, Karl Shephard was on hand to poke it into the net.
The Irish continued to pressurise the Slovenian defence in the second half, substitute, Darragh Satelle went agonisingly close with a header while Paul Murphy should have doubled the score when he missed a free header at the back post.
Vincent Butlers men had to wait until the 73rd minute of play for their second goal, Mervue Uniteds Greg Cunningham fired an unstoppable shot from outside the box which left the Slovenian goalkeeper with no chance.
Vincent Butler said after the game, "I am very pleased with the result, I felt that we should have won the first game on Tuesday, I am absolutely delighted for the boys as this is a learning curve for them, this is a two year process in which many of the players will be playing in the UEFA Under 17 Championships qualifiers with Sean McCaffrey"
